怎么把一个Assembly,写入到数据库中去!!

csdn_bob 2003-08-24 06:19:35
Assembly a = cr.CompiledAssembly;

用什么方法可以得到程序集的流的表示?

GetManifestResourceStream是这个函数吗??!
怎么用?
...全文
43 8 打赏 收藏 转发到动态 举报
写回复
用AI写文章
8 条回复
切换为时间正序
请发表友善的回复…
发表回复
heroux 2003-08-25
  • 打赏
  • 举报
回复
GetManifestResourceStream是一个获取配件中资源部分的流
可以考虑用GetManifestExecuteStream,
Jim3 2003-08-25
  • 打赏
  • 举报
回复
Assembly.GetFiles()不知道可不可以
关注
csdn_bob 2003-08-25
  • 打赏
  • 举报
回复
to Jim3:
mark??
Jim3 2003-08-25
  • 打赏
  • 举报
回复
mark
csdn_bob 2003-08-25
  • 打赏
  • 举报
回复
to 楼上:
我生成的程序集在内存中,我不想再存到文件,然后再读文件到数据表中!

应该可以直接取得程序集的二进制流!
timmy3310 2003-08-25
  • 打赏
  • 举报
回复
你直接用二进制方式打开文件读不就行了吗
csdn_bob 2003-08-25
  • 打赏
  • 举报
回复
up..
up..
csdn_bob 2003-08-25
  • 打赏
  • 举报
回复
to 楼上:
GetManifestExecuteStream在哪呀?怎么在msdn中没有找到这个方法?

请指点!
DFrame是一个轻量级ORM框架。它内部集成SQLHelper组件和Dapper框架。 DFrame.Common命名空间集成: 1:EncryptDecrypt(AES/Base64/DES/HmacSha/MD5/SHA/RSA); 2:HttpService 服务类; 3:ImageClass 图片操作; 4:Json json操作; 5:ListComparer 按实体字段去重; 6:Mail 电子邮件操作; 7:QRCode 生成二维码和解读二维码; 8:SMS 短信接口 阿里云; 9:Tools 其他工具包; 10:UserInfo 获取用户信息。 DFrame.DAL命名空间集成: 1:Access 数据库操作类; 2:MySQL 数据库操作类; 3:SQLServer 数据库操作类; 4:生成MySQL数据库方法; 5:生成SQLServer数据库方法; 例如,执行以下代码: Assembly ass = Assembly.Load("Models"); DFrame.DAL.SQLFactory.Create(DFrame.DAL.SQLFactory.DatabaseType.MSSQLServer, "test1", ass); 将会“Models”命名空间下的所有已集成DFrame.Model.DBModel抽象类的实体类,写入到MSSQLServer的"test1"数据库。 实体字段设定: [DFrame.Model.DBField(NotNull = true,DBFieldKey =DFrame.Model.Enums.DBFieldKey.Unique,DefaultValue ="默认",ForeignKey =typeof(Person),Lenght =4001)] public string Text { get; set; } //其NotNull设定是否可空; //其DBFieldKey键类型; //其DefaultValue设定默认值; //其ForeignKey设定外键; //其Lenght设定长度; DFrame.Model命名空间: 1:提供DFrame.DAL下的生成数据库用的一些抽象类; 2:命名空间内部已集成简单的SQLHelper操作类。并对继承DFrame.Model.DBModel抽象类的实体提供lambda语句查询方法(目前只支持MSSQLServer数据库)。 lambda查询支持的方法有: 1: long Count() 2: List ToList() 3: int Delete()

110,571

社区成员

发帖
与我相关
我的任务
社区描述
.NET技术 C#
社区管理员
  • C#
  • Web++
  • by_封爱
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告

让您成为最强悍的C#开发者

试试用AI创作助手写篇文章吧